Abstract: Objective To evaluate the feasibility and efficacy of the dual ultrasonic lithotriptor system combined with multi-point puncture standard channels technique in patients with renal staghorn calculi.Methods Analysis was made in 268 renal staghorn calculi patients, males 148,females 120,average age 18- 68 years old.Coupled with water collection systems (including the expansion of a kidney)accounted for 186 cases,pyometra amounted to 26 cases.All the patients were treated with dual ultrasonic lithotriptor system combined with multi-point puncture standard channels technique.General anesthesia or peridural anesthesia(in the two stage procedure)was applied.The standard channels,the punctures of renal pelvis and calyces were created under the color Doppler ultrasound guide.Results A total of 270 standard channels,486 point punctures of renal pelvis and calyces were made in the 268 patients.Among them,19 patients treated with 4 punctures,27 patients created with 3 punctures,107 patients created with 2 punctures,115 patients created with 1 puncture.The mean calculi removal time was 45.4 minutes. One-stage calculi clearance rate was 96.6%(259/268).Two-stage calculi clearance rate was 98.9%(265/268).Nine patients needed blood transfusion (3.4%).Interventional therapy technique was deployed in four patients (1.5%).Twenty-six patients complained postoperative fever (9.7%).No deaths occurred.There were no nephrectomy cases.Conclusion Dual ultrasonic lithotriptor system combined with multi-point puncture standard channels technique guided by color Doppler ultrasound in patients with renal staghorn calculi is safe and effective in quickly removal of calculi,also reducing the complications.
